AIMEE HOUSE

ROCKY MOUNT - Aimee House, passed away August 11, 2024. Aimee was preceded in death by her father, John Barnes and nephews, Jaydon Gibson and Kal-El Barnes.

She is survived by her husband of 23 years, Chad House; children, Aubrey, Wyatt and Lolly House; mother, Angela Barnes; brother, Chris Barnes (Melissa), all of Greenville; parents-in-law, Steve and Fran House; brother-in-law, Matt House (Paige) of Macclesfield; nieces and nephews and several aunts, uncles.

A special gathering will be held August 16, 2024 from 6 - 8 p.m. at Davis-Little Funerals, 2129 Lawrence Circle, Rocky Mount. A graveside service will follow at 11 a.m., Saturday, August 17, 2024 at Aubin Faith Family Cemetery (the family homeplace) with Pastor Scott Sherrod officiating.

In lieu of flowers, memorial donations may be made to Down East Baptist Church, PO Box 113, Pinetops, NC 27864.
